Every year between mid-November and mid-December, thousands of year 12 students head to holiday destinations around Victoria and Australia to celebrate the end of school. It's an opportunity to relax after a hard year's work, spend time with your mates and celebrate the end of school.
Most people have the time of their lives at schoolies, but things can go wrong. Drink-spiking, sexual assault, violence, and alcohol and drug abuse can all turn a great schoolies experience into something you'd rather forget.
